Why Choose a Robot Vacuum for Dog Hair?
Robot vacuums have actually rapidly gained popularity over the last few years, particularly amongst pet owners. Here are some reasons they are an excellent option for tackling dog hair:
Convenience: Robot vacuums automate the cleansing procedure, allowing pet owners to set up cleaning sessions while they are away, decreasing the burden of everyday cleaning.Performance: Many robot vacuums are created with powerful suction and specialized brushes that successfully catch pet hair and dander from different surfaces.Accessibility: Most models can easily navigate under furniture, reaching spots that conventional vacuums typically battle with.Smart Technology: Many robot vacuums include smart mapping, permitting them to keep in mind the design of your home and clean more effectively over time.Key Features to Consider
When searching for the perfect robot vacuum to handle dog hair, a number of features must be considered:
FeatureValueSuction PowerStrong suction is important for efficiently picking up pet hair.Brush DesignTangle-free brushes and rubber bristles are ideal for pet hair.Purification SystemHEPA filters help trap allergens and fine particles.Battery LifeLonger battery life aids in cleaning up larger locations without interruption.Smart FeaturesWi-Fi connectivity, app control, and voice assistant compatibility improve convenience.Navigation TechnologyAdvanced navigation sensors help prevent challenges and effectively cover the area.Dustbin CapacityLarger dustbins require less regular emptying, saving time.Top Robot Vacuums for Dog Hair

The iRobot Roomba s9+ is a state-of-the-art model that boasts 40 times stronger suction than previous models. Its dual rubber brushes are created to prevent tangles and effectively capture pet hair, while the innovative filtering system helps lower irritants. With smart mapping innovation and over 120 minutes of battery life, it's perfect for larger homes.
2. Roborock S7
The Roborock S7 includes excellent suction power and a multifunctional brush design that quickly handles dog hair. Its self-cleaning capability and app connection supply ease of use, along with a battery life of as much as 180 minutes, making it perfect for comprehensive cleaning sessions in larger spaces.
3. Neato Botvac D7
The Neato Botvac D7 is well-known for its D-shape style, permitting it to tidy corners efficiently. With effective suction and a HEPA filter that captures irritants, it's a great choice for pet owners. Its ability to develop no-go zones through the app adds a layer of personalization that lots of users appreciate.
4. Eufy RoboVac G30 Edge
A more budget-friendly choice, the Eufy RoboVac G30 Edge provides strong suction power and a 3-point cleansing system. While it lacks some innovative functions of more costly models, it is dependable and effective for basic dog hair elimination, and its app control includes convenience.
5. Shark ION Robot Vacuum
The Shark ION Robot Vacuum, while on the lower end of the rate spectrum, uses decent suction and is geared up with a bristle brush to get pet hair. It's suitable for pet owners looking for an affordable entry-level design.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How often should I run my robot vacuum to handle dog hair?
Running your robot vacuum daily or every other day can help keep pet hair under control, especially throughout shedding seasons.
2. Can robot vacuums handle big dog breeds?
Yes, many modern robot vacuums have strong suction power and specialized brushes that work for getting hair from big dog breeds.
3. Are robot vacuums safe for pets?
Yes, robot vacuums are typically safe for pets. However, it is a good idea to monitor your pet's interaction with the vacuum, particularly if they are skittish around gizmos.
4. Do robot vacuums need maintenance?
Yes, regular upkeep includes emptying the dustbin, cleaning filters, and examining brushes for hair tangles. This guarantees ideal performance and longevity.
5. Can robot vacuums navigate stairs?
The majority of robot vacuums are not created to navigate stairs. It's necessary to keep staircases clear to prevent your vacuum from falling.
